CS 210 - Introduction to Geographic Information Systems (GIS)


This course serves as an introduction to Geographic Information Systems (GIS). Students will be introduced to the fundamental principles and practices of  GIS. This course will focus on spatial data development and analysis of this data. Topics covered will include basic data structures, data sources, data collection, data quality, understanding maps, building a GIS, Global Navigation Satellite Systems, digital data, attribute data and tables, and basic spatial analysis. 

Four credits.

Prerequisite(s): Courses open to all majors - no prerequisite.
